Summary Root canal treatment involves the mechanical removal of the affected pulp tissue, shaping of the root canal system, disinfection and subsequent root filling. The procedures are performed through an access opening in the crown of the tooth. The ultimate goal is to eliminate the microorganisms promote healing and bone reformation in order to be able to save the tooth for the foreseeable future
